  • Fire resistance ceiling system is the structure of which the ceiling installed under the slave of the structure has the fire resistance performance. Because of having the fire resistance performance, fire resistive coatings on steel beams can be reduced and large span structures can be constructed. So, it have advantages of convenience for construction, shorten for construction time and cost reducing. In foreign country, it is general that one system consisting of slave and ceiling is constructed as a fire resistance system. But in Korea, there are no fire resistance ceiling systems thus economical efficiency due to being high-rise and light-weight of structures is not secured. Therefore research and development of nominal fire resistance ceiling systems is necessary. On this study, fire resistances of standard non-loadbearing ceiling systems were assessed and basic informations for developing the fire resistance non-loadbearing ceiling systems were presented.

  • Fire-resistant boom is one of the most important facilities in in situ homing of spilled oil. Thermal response of a fire-resistant boom to turning is experimentally investigated in this paper by using an electric furnace and a burning test facility. This test facility is composed of a test tank, a fire boom, a hood for inhaling smoke, an incinerator for burning up gases and thermocouples, etc. Thereby a systematic method of approach in small laboratory scale is developed to study the performance of a fire-resistant boom. Burning test is carried out for the fire boom model which has been developed through the present study. It is shown that the present fire boom model has capability to withstand the high temperature around 800℃ and high rate of heat flux on it due to homing. For more realistic experimental environments, larger dimensions in devices and longer time in experiments are recommended in near future.

  • 방화댐퍼는 방화구획을 관통하는 덕트에 설치되어 화염의 전파 및 연소확대를 방지하도록 하는 방화설비로서 '건축물의 피난 방화구조 등의 기준에 관한 규칙'에서 구조 및 시험기준에 대해서 규정하고 있으나, 정해진 성능기준이 없으며 방화설비에 있어 가장 중요한 내화성능에 대해서 언급이 없는 등 개정이 필요하다. 본 연구에서는 방화댐퍼의 'KS F2840(방화댐퍼의 내화시험방법)'시험에 대해서 소개하고, 방화댐퍼의 내화시험 사례를 통해 성능 평가방법으로서의 적용 타당성을 검토하였다.

  • This study aims at evaluation of the fire resistance performance of cementitious materials for fire protection of tunnel. For this purpose, the research procedure was divided into three parts. First, base mix proportion with different material type were determined by fire test. Second, the fire test of cementitious materials for fire resistance were performed on base mix proportions to evaluated their performance. Third, the performance of cementitious materials for fire resistance compare to the target value and existing commercial products. If the performance of developed cemetitious materials for fire resistance were satisfied the target value, this studies were stopped. But, this research return to first process if the performance of cementitious materials for fire resistance are not satisfied the target value. As a result of this study, the spalling did not happen for develop and existing commercial product. Also, developed cementitious materials for fire resistance are shown with excellent compressive strength, flexural strength, and bond strength, because it used a height density aggregate. And developed cementitious materials has sufficient resistance for fire.

  • 국내에서는 방화구획을 설정하여 화재 확산 방지 및 재실자의 대피 시간을 확보하고 있다. 방화구획에 설치되는 방화문은 방화문의 내화시험방법(KS F 2268-1)에 따라 시험을 거쳐 성적서를 발급 받은 제품에 대해 설치하도록 의무화 하고 있다. 그러나 본 시험방법은 시험체 제작, 설치 및 의뢰시험비용 등 상당한 비용이 소요될 뿐 아니라 제작, 설치, 시험에 소요되는 시간 또한 길다. 축소실험장치는 목재방화문 개발 중 재료의 내화성능을 평가할 장치로 개발되었으며, 표준시간-가열 온도곡선을 상회하는 가열실험을 통해 재료의 내화성능 결과를 얻을 수 있다. 본 실험에서는 난연 또는 불연성능이 뛰어난 재료를 대상으로 실험하였으며, 그 결과 난연목재는 5분, 마그네슘보드와 내화 직물원단은 60분의 내화성능을 갖춘 것으로 확인되었다. 이 결과를 토대로 방화문의 내화시험방법과 상관성을 도출하여 목재방화문 개발의 지표로 활용 가능하게 되었다.

  • The purpose of this paper is to evaluate the fire resistant performances of load-bearing wall using both composite and steel stud panel infilled with light-weight formed mortar under axial loading according to KS F 2257(1999). The minimum requirement of 2 hours fire resistant rating is needed for the residential and commercial buildings under the fire regulation of Korea. From test results, it is found that two types of specimen composed of the hybrid stud and steel stud panel filled with light-weight formed mortar fited in with the requirement of 2 hours fire resisting rate for the load-bearing wall. In the conclusions, the specimen with hybrid stud shows predominating fire-resistant performance on the adiabatic effects rather than that of the steel stud specimen.
